TURN-208: Gatevale turnstile counters at the Merrow Field pilot double-count when a rotation reverses mid-cycle. Attendance totals drift roughly 2% high per event. The debounce window fix is implemented, reviewed by Ilsa, and soak-tested across two simulated match days without drift. Ready for your cut; the candidate build is identified below.

trace token, tagag-tafog: htk6_5ed18c

Subject: Quickstore 4.2 — bloom filter now fronts the KV layer

Plugin authors: starting with this release, Quickstore places a bloom filter ahead of the key-value store. Negative lookups return faster; false positives fall through safely. No API changes are required on your side. Verify your plugin against the staging build referenced below.

session token of fahif-tadup = htk3_9c7

The Nightloom scheduler kicks off data backfills between 01:00 and 05:00, and every trigger, pause, or reschedule call has to be authenticated — no anonymous endpoints, promise. For the security review: auth is a static bearer key scoped to the scheduler's admin plane only, so it can't touch the underlying warehouse. Rotation is monthly and logged. To reproduce our test calls against staging, use the key below.

service key, fawip-bajef: kto11_Qt5wZK9vdNC